LEMOORE, Calif. (KFSN) -- An arrest has been made in a child pornography case with ties to Lemoore Naval Air Station. But it took authorities hundreds of miles from the South Valley to make it happen.
Michael Brandon Kiper, 29, is in the custody of the Navy following his arrest for producing child pornography.
The sailor was stationed in Lemoore for a little more than a year before he was arrested and charged with child pornography.
Federal investigators and the United States Navy remain tight-lipped on the arrest of Michael Brandon Kiper. But a criminal complaint filed with the United States district court reveals a five month-long investigation with four underage victims since 2012.
Police in Pennsylvania first got wind of the crimes back in January after a 14-year-old girl reported her contact with a man online known as "James White."
It turned out to Kiper, who investigators say had the girl send him sexually explicit photos through an online messaging site, and then threatened to publish them if she didn't send him more. The girl told her mom who told police.
Investigators detail that Kiper lured the girls into thinking they could become models.
The complaint states victim one telling Kiper she wanted to "Wait till June and I turn 15" to start "modeling."
To which he replies "Why wait when you can do it now? You're lucky I still have an open spot."
Once the Naval Criminal Investigative Service or NCIS got involved, they discovered three more victims, all younger than 16 years old. NCIS believe Michael Kiper was sending and receiving sexually explicit photos and videos with the minors.
On May 1st of this year investigators served a search warrant at Kiper's apartment on the base in Lemoore, and shortly afterwards he all but disappeared. His military status was changed to "unauthorized absence" and is now facing charges for being a deserter of the United States Navy.
Kiper was eventually caught up with in Oklahoma where he was arrested and brought back to California.
Investigators say they found more than 50 child pornography videos and photos on his electronic devices.
Michael Kiper is expected to be brought up to Fresno to face the federal child pornography charges against him, he'll also face a Navy court for his desertion charges.
